VPN protocols for UniFi: WireGuard, OpenVPN, IPsec, L2TP
WireGuard
- Pros: Higher throughput, lower latency, smaller codebase, easier to audit, fast connection establishment.
- Cons: Some consumer devices and older UniFi gear have spotty support or require firmware updates. some VPN providers offer WireGuard “over TLS” or obfuscated variants to evade blocking.
- Best practice for UniFi: Use WireGuard for remote access where possible or for site-to-site links between UniFi devices, especially on newer UniFi OS versions that support WireGuard routes and peers.
OpenVPN
- Pros: Excellent compatibility, mature client ecosystem, strong community support, flexible configuration.
- Cons: Slightly heavier encryption overhead. can be slower than WireGuard on the same hardware.
- Best practice for UniFi: Keep OpenVPN as a reliable fallback when you need broader client compatibility or if your hardware lacks WireGuard support.
IPsec IKEv2
- Pros: Excellent performance on many devices, strong security options, widely supported for site-to-site and remote access.
- Cons: Configuration can be verbose. some consumer-grade devices require careful NAT traversal settings.
- Best practice for UniFi: Use IPsec for robust, enterprise-grade site-to-site deployments or when you need seamless client support across a broad device set.
L2TP over IPsec
- Pros: Good compatibility, easier to set up on some older devices.
- Cons: Generally slower. more prone to blocking on some networks. less favored for new deployments.
- Best practice for UniFi: Reserve for legacy devices that cannot handle WireGuard or OpenVPN.
Quick comparison for UniFi users
- If your hardware and UniFi OS version support WireGuard well: choose WireGuard for speed and simplicity.
- If you need broad compatibility across Windows/macOS/iOS/Android with minimal tinkering: OpenVPN remains a strong choice.
- If you’re connecting multiple sites and care about performance with strict policy controls: IPsec is a solid option.
- If you’re reusing existing OpenVPN configurations or client profiles: OpenVPN continues to be a safe bet.

Step-by-step: setting up VPNs for UniFi remote access and site-to-site
Note: The exact steps depend on your UniFi hardware UDM, USG, or a dedicated firewall and the VPN protocol you choose. The steps below are practical anchors you can adapt.

A. Decide your VPN model
- Remote access VPN: Each user connects individually to your network.
- Site-to-site VPN: Two or more locations connect as a single network with shared routes.
B. Choose your protocol
- WireGuard: Best for speed. use if your UniFi OS version supports it cleanly.
- OpenVPN: Best for broad compatibility with older devices or clients.
- IPsec: Great for site-to-site deployments or devices with native IPsec support.
C. Prepare your UniFi device
- Check firmware: Ensure your UniFi hardware runs a recent UniFi OS version with VPN support improvements.
- Create a dedicated VPN network: Use the UniFi Network app to define a new VPN network or route-based VPN if your hardware supports it.
- Firewall rules: Permit VPN traffic to reach the VPN server and block unwanted access to sensitive resources on the LAN.
D. Configure the VPN server on your UniFi device or a trusted gateway
- WireGuard
- Generate key pairs for server and clients.
- Create a peer on the UniFi side and push client configs to endpoints.
- Define allowed IPs and routing for each peer.
- OpenVPN
- Generate server certificate and client certificates.
- Export client profiles for users. deploy on devices.
- Configure tunnel traffic rules and DNS settings.
- IPsec
- Create IKE policies, IPsec phase 1 and phase 2 settings.
- Create VPN tunnels site-to-site or remote access.
- Configure client access if remote or gateway-to-gateway rules if site-to-site.
E. Client provisioning and management
- Provide users with configuration files or app profiles.
- Enable two-factor authentication 2FA for VPN accounts where possible.
- Set up split tunneling if you only want VPN traffic to flow over the tunnel not all traffic.
F. Test and validate
- Connect from a known external network and verify access to LAN resources.
- Confirm DNS resolution through the VPN when needed and verify there are no leaks.
- Run throughput tests to confirm you meet expected performance targets.
G. Ongoing maintenance
- Rotate keys or certificates on a regular schedule.
- Review VPN logs for unusual access patterns.
- Update firmware and VPN configs after major UniFi OS updates.
Security best practices for UniFi VPNs
- Use a kill switch to ensure traffic doesn’t leak if the VPN drops.
- Enable DNS leak protection to prevent local DNS queries from escaping the tunnel.
- Prefer WireGuard where possible for a lightweight attack surface and speed, but maintain OpenVPN/IPsec as fallbacks for compatibility.
- For site-to-site, limit exposure by using strict routing rules and only allow necessary subnets.
- Enforce MFA for VPN access when the option exists.
- Regularly audit access control lists ACLs and firewall rules to ensure least-privilege exposure.
Performance and hardware considerations
- Hardware matters: A modern UniFi Dream Router UDR/UDM or USG with a capable CPU handles VPN workloads better than older hardware. If you’re pushing high-throughput or many concurrent connections, you’ll want a device with strong VPN acceleration support or offload capabilities.
- Protocol choice affects load: WireGuard usually delivers higher throughput with lower CPU overhead than OpenVPN on similar hardware.
- Bandwidth planning: Plan for headroom. If your Internet connection is, say, 1 Gbps down/up, note that VPN encryption, routing, and internal NICs can become bottlenecks. Expect some overhead and test under real workloads.
- Split tunneling can boost performance: If you don’t need all traffic to pass through the VPN, use split tunneling to route only corporate or lab traffic via the VPN, keeping general Internet traffic on the local WAN.
Common pitfalls and troubleshooting
- Double NAT and misrouted traffic: Ensure your VPN network’s subnets don’t clash with LAN subnets. adjust NAT or routing as needed.
- Port forwarding and firewall blocks: Some setups require explicit port openings for VPN protocols. verify that your firewall rules allow VPN traffic on the correct ports.
- Incompatible clients: If you support many devices, test across OS versions to identify any client-specific quirks.
- Certificate/keys rotation: When rotating certificates or changing keys, update clients promptly to avoid disconnects.
- Firmware drift: Major UniFi OS updates can change VPN features. revalidate your config after upgrades.
Monitoring, logging, and ongoing management
- Keep an eye on VPN session counts and user activity to detect unusual patterns.
- Use simple metrics: connection uptime, average latency, and typical throughput per user or per site.
- Document your topology: site-to-site VPN peers, remote-access users, and the subnets allowed behind each VPN.
- Regular audits: Quarterly reviews of VPN configuration, firewall rules, and access lists help maintain security posture.

Can I set up a VPN on a UniFi Dream Machine?
A: Yes, many users configure VPNs on UniFi Dream Machine models, including remote-access VPNs and site-to-site setups. The exact steps depend on your firmware version and the VPN protocol you choose.
Should I use WireGuard or IPsec for site-to-site VPNs?
A: If your sites and devices support WireGuard well, it’s often faster and simpler. IPsec remains a strong choice for broader device compatibility and mature enterprise-grade deployments.
How do I enable split tunneling with UniFi VPNs?

Can I have multiple VPNs on the same UniFi network?
A: Yes, it’s possible to run different VPNs for different purposes e.g., WireGuard for remote access and IPsec for site-to-site. You’ll need careful routing and firewall planning to avoid conflicts.
What are common VPN bottlenecks on UniFi hardware?
A: CPU limits, VPN encryption overhead, and NIC throughput are typical bottlenecks. If you notice slowdowns, consider upgrading hardware, enabling split tunneling, or adjusting the protocol to the one that best suits your workload.
How do I test my VPN setup after configuration?
A: From an external network, connect to the VPN and verify access to internal resources e.g., NAS, admin interfaces. Check DNS resolution through the VPN, and run speed tests to benchmark performance.
Is VPN logging a privacy risk, and how should I handle it?
A: VPN logs can reveal connection times, bandwidth, and client IPs. Use providers with clear privacy policies, configure the minimum necessary logs, and enable MFA where possible. On UniFi, keep your own device logs private and secure.

How do I troubleshoot VPN connectivity issues on UniFi?
A: Start with basic checks: confirm firmware versions, verify that the VPN server is reachable, check firewall rules, ensure the correct ports are open, and test with a known-good client profile. If issues persist, trial a different protocol to isolate problems.
Do VPNs affect latency noticeably for gaming or streaming?
A: They can. WireGuard typically reduces latency vs OpenVPN, but VPN routing adds an extra hop. If you’re gaming or streaming, optimize by choosing a nearby server and enabling split tunneling for non-game traffic.
Is there a risk of VPNs breaking UniFi updates?
A: Sometimes, major firmware updates adjust VPN features or security defaults. Always test VPNs after a firmware upgrade and be ready to reapply or adjust settings as needed.
